(i) To change the touch threshold on individual channels, click on “Read Thres”. This
will display the current settings.
question by selecting the desired value from the drop down box, and click on “Write
Thres” as indicated in Figure 3.4.
(ii) To change the base value of current samples that the Auto-ATI algorithm tunes the
touch channels to, enter a new value under “ATI Settings:” (500 in the example).
Under “ATI Settings:” click on “Send”. Whenever “Auto-ATI” is clicked on, the algorithm
will retune the current samples to the selected base value. Lower base values: More
stable, faster response times. Higher base values: More sensitive.
(iii) To make one or more channels more sensitive, the ATI compensation parameter
can be adjusted as follows (See Figure 3.5). Under “ATI Comp” click on “Read” to
display the current compensation values. Enter a new value between 0 and 63 for the
channel that is to be adjusted, and click on “Write”. A higher compensation value will
yield higher current samples, and thus will make the channel more sensitive.
